How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Orchards?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Orchards Studio Apartments | $1,362 | $1,196 | $1,890 |
Orchards 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,677 | $1,221 | $2,301 |
Orchards 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,992 | $1,300 | $3,107 |
Orchards 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,502 | $1,750 | $5,100 |
Orchards 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Orchards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Orchards?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Orchards is at Vintage at Vancouver listed at $1,106.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Orchards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Orchards is $1,727.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Orchards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Orchards is a 1,500 square feet unit starting from $1,395 at Alder Creek Apartments.
What is the average size for Orchards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Orchards is currently at 714 sq ft.
